There could have been no more popular a winner of the British Open Championship at the Festival of British Eventing, presented by BETA at Gatcombe Park, than Ruth Edge.
After posting the competition's best dressage score of 27.1, Ruth Mayhem III produced the only double clear in the show jumping and cross-country phases to lead from start to finish.
It was a consummate performance from one of Eventing's most professional and hard working but likeable stars. Although a handful of the best of the Brits were absent this year, having already left for the Olympics in Hong Kong, Ruth and Mayhem would still surely have been unbeatable.
In fact, Ruth herself very nearly made the Olympic team with her more experienced ride Two Thyme, a British Open winner of four years ago. However, the British team's loss where an injury removed them from the reserve list proved to be Gatcombe's gain.
